Hole in the Rock

Hole in the Rock is a captivating natural landmark located within Papago Park, one of Phoenix, Arizona’s most beloved outdoor recreational areas. This unique geological formation is a massive red sandstone butte featuring a large, naturally formed hole or opening that offers stunning panoramic views of the city and surrounding desert landscape. The Hole in the Rock is easily accessible via a short, family-friendly hike that winds through scenic desert terrain dotted with iconic saguaro cacti and native plant life, making it a favorite spot for both locals and visitors seeking a blend of nature and adventure.

 

The trail to Hole in the Rock is relatively easy, suitable for hikers of all ages and skill levels, making it an excellent destination for families, photographers, and outdoor enthusiasts. As visitors ascend the gentle slope, they can appreciate the vibrant colors of the sandstone, shaped over millions of years by wind and water erosion, and gain a firsthand experience of Arizona’s unique desert ecosystem. Once at the top, the large hole in the rock frames breathtaking views of downtown Phoenix, Camelback Mountain, and the vast Sonoran Desert, providing a perfect spot for capturing memorable photos or simply soaking in the natural beauty.

 

Papago Park itself is rich in history and offers more than just the Hole in the Rock. The park encompasses expansive picnic areas, fishing lagoons, golf courses, and the Desert Botanical Garden, which showcases an impressive collection of desert flora from around the world. It is also home to the Phoenix Zoo, making the entire area a vibrant destination for outdoor recreation and family fun. The Hole in the Rock is a standout attraction within this park, offering a peaceful yet awe-inspiring experience close to the heart of the city.
